Answer:
k = - 6
Step-by-step explanation:
Since (x - 2) is a factor then x = 2 is a root
Substitute x = 2 into the polynomial and equate to zero, that is
2³ + k(2)² + 12(2) - 8 = 0
8 + 4k + 24 - 8 = 0
4k + 24 = 0 ( subtract 24 from both sides )
4k = - 24 ( divide both sides by 4 )
k = - 6
